Liverpool AGREE £12m deal for Sevilla defender Alberto Moreno

LIVERPOOL have agreed a £12m deal for Sevilla left-back Alberto Moreno and the player is now set to be pulled out of tonight’s Uefa Super Cup showdown with Real Madrid.

Anfield chief executive Ian Ayre finalised negotiations with the Spanish club in Cardiff today ahead of the showpiece game.

Leaving Liverpool, however, is Martin Kelly who will seek to revive his injury-scarred career at Crystal Palace in a £1.5m deal.

Moreno, 22, will now travel to Merseyside for a medical ahead of becoming manager Brendan Rodgers’ latest summer signing after the captures of Rickie Lambert, Adam Lallana, Dejan Lovren, Lazar Markovic, Divok Origi, Javier Manquillo and Emre Can.

Left-back has become a problem position for Liverpool following the knee injury sustained by Jose Enrique last season and Moreno will provide strong competition to his fellow Spaniard who has just returned from a lengthy spell out.

Quick and comfortable marauding forward, Moreno did not make the final cut for Spain’s World Cup squad but has been likened to Barcelona’s Jordi Alba.

He was expected to play his final game for Sevilla tonight against Real, but has now been pulled out to avoid injury and the prospect of the deal collapsing.

Kelly, meanwhile, will look to boost his fortunes after playing just eight games last season after recovering from a cruciate knee injury.

From the Liverpool Echo, most trusted source

Liverpool FC have agreed a deal with Sevilla to sign left-back Alberto Moreno.

The Reds will pay around £12million up front with the fee rising with various add-ons.

Chief executive Ian Ayre completed negotiations with the La Liga outfit in Cardiff ahead of tonight's UEFA Super Cup final against Real Madrid.

As a result Moreno was withdrawn from the Sevilla side and will instead head for Merseyside to discuss personal terms and undergo a medical.

The 22-year-old Spain international has been pursued by Liverpool all summer and will become Brendan Rodgers' eighth signing of this window.

As Moreno checks in, Martin Kelly's Anfield career is coming to an end. The Reds have agreed to sell the 24-year-old defender to Crystal Palace for around £1.5million.
